ChatWork 表示法
關於表示法
在 ChatWork 內有一套專屬在訊息、工作及描述欄位內使用的表示法。
您可以運用這套表示法讓資訊更容易閱覽,也能夠活用 To 或是回覆等等功能。
ChatWork 的表示法使用
[ ]
方括號來標記、就如同 HTML 語法使用< >
來做標記一般。
其標示法分為這種單獨標記的方式
[tagname:value]
或[tagname attr=value]
以及[tagname]...[/tagname]
這樣的包圍在起始標記及終止標記方式。
在以下表示法說明中,使用
{ }
符號標記例如{account_id}
或{room_id}
這種標記方式可以用來表示帳號ID或是 room ID 等等資料。而...
則用來表示任意文字。To
To為一個可以指定對象來傳送訊息的功能。
收到To訊息的成員的介面訊息背景會變色,和未讀訊息的數量也會分開表示,這麼一來訊息可以立刻被查覺,不容易遺漏。
To標籤只會表示To的標籤以及訊息傳送對象的大頭照,而且旁邊會自動標記名字,使用起來非常方便。範例:[To:123] 山田
您可以在一封訊息內複數標記TO標籤,也就是說您可以一次傳TO訊息給多人。
回覆
[rp aid={account_id} to={room_id}-{message_id}]
回覆和To有些類似,但回覆功能主要為回覆指定訊息。
在 ChatWork 上點擊「RE」圖示,便可查看所回覆的訊息內容。
引用
[qt][qtmeta aid={account_id} time={timestamp}]...[/qt]
可以引用指定的文章。
參數 aid 請填入欲引用文章之發佈者的帳號 account_id 以及該訊息發佈時間 (請使用 Unix 時間格式填入)。
[qt][qtmeta aid={account_id}]...[/qt]
此外,如上所示 time 可以省略。若省略將不會顯示該訊息引用的發佈時間。
API認證方法
Endpoints (資料傳輸接點)
ChatWork API 的 Endpoints 項目
ChatWork表示法
RAML